Plant Controller - chemical sector

This position supports industrial control activities, contributing to the development of reporting systems, the valorization of industrial data, and the optimization of the plant's production and financial processes.

Main activities

  • Processing of the monthly Capex report, including order verification in coordination with the Purchasing Office and checking the alignment of data from the management system
  • Preparation of the monthly sales report and analysis of the main commercial dynamics
  • Periodic inventory valuation and verification of correct cost allocation, with particular attention to high-value raw materials, semi-finished products and work-in-progress products
  • Management, updating and maintenance of product sheets, including: raw material costs, consumables, department hourly costs, processing cycles and theoretical/actual yields per process phase
  • Monitoring industrial margins and analyzing deviations from standards, budgets, and forecasts
  • Production reporting for yield analysis and economic impact assessment of process changes
  • Implementation and review of the cost accounting system, including cost center remapping
  • Monitoring the progress of investments against the approved budget, supporting the company's decision-making process
  • Introduction of specific controls on raw material orders related to investment projects
  • Support the Group Controller in key controlling activities and financial and economic analyses.
